如何构建一个安全的USDT钱包:源代码解析与最佳

              发布时间:2025-01-13 18:49:15
              ## 内容主体大纲 1. **引言** - USDT的定义与背景 - 为什么需要一个USDT钱包 2. **USDT钱包的基本功能** - 存储与转账功能 - 查询余额与交易历史 3. **USDT钱包的类型** - 热钱包和冷钱包的区别 - 社区钱包与个人钱包的选择 4. **USDT钱包的源代码解析** - 开源钱包的优势 - 解析钱包源码中的关键函数 5. **构建一个简单的USDT钱包** - 所需环境与工具 - 创建钱包的基本步骤 6. **USDT钱包的安全性** - 常见的安全隐患 - 如何防范黑客攻击 7. **钱包的最佳实践** - 定期备份与恢复 - 加强个人信息的保护 8. **总结与前瞻** - 未来的USDT钱包发展趋势 - 用户的角色与责任 9. **相关问题解答** - 6个有关USDT钱包的常见问题 ## 详细内容 ### 1. 引言

              USDT(Tether)是一种一种以美元为基础的稳定币,它通过将其价值与美元1:1挂钩,从而抵御加密货币市场的波动性。近几年来,USDT成为了加密货币交易中的重要组成部分,广泛用于交易所间的兑换和资产转移。

              为了安全存储和操作USDT,用户必须拥有一个功能完善且安全的USDT钱包。无论是个人投资者还是企业用户,了解并构建一个USDT钱包的重要性显而易见。

              ### 2. USDT钱包的基本功能 #### 存储与转账功能

              USDT钱包的最基本功能包括资产存储与转账。用户可以通过他们的钱包安全地存储USDT,并可以随时进行转账,转账流程通常涉及到输入接收方钱包地址、转账金额、以及交易确认等步骤。

              #### 查询余额与交易历史

              此外,用户还可以随时查询余额和交易历史。可以通过调用区块链上的相关数据,钱包能够实时显示用户当前的USDT余额以及之前的所有交易记录。这一功能对用户的资产管理尤为重要。

              ### 3. USDT钱包的类型 #### 热钱包和冷钱包的区别

              USDT钱包主要分为热钱包和冷钱包。热钱包常常连接互联网,便于快速交易,但安全性较低。而冷钱包如硬件钱包,则断网保存,安全性更高,但在使用时需要更烦琐的流程。

              #### 社区钱包与个人钱包的选择

              此外,还有社区钱包与个人钱包的选择。社区钱包往往由一群开发者维护,适合一般用户;而个人钱包则可以让用户掌控私人密钥,更加安全,但要求用户具备一定的技术知识。

              ### 4. USDT钱包的源代码解析 #### 开源钱包的优势

              许多USDT钱包采用开源代码,这意味着所有人都可以查看、使用和修改源代码。开源钱包的一个主要优势是透明性,用户可以确保钱包运作的安全与可信。

              #### 解析钱包源码中的关键函数

              具体到源代码,用户需要关注如地址生成、交易签名、解锁与锁定功能等关键函数。这些基本函数是USDT钱包正常运行的核心部分。每个函数的设计与实现都可能直接影响钱包的安全性与使用体验。

              ### 5. 构建一个简单的USDT钱包 #### 所需环境与工具

              在构建一个简单的USDT钱包之前,用户需要准备开发环境,包括Node.js、相关的数据库和基本的前端框架。熟悉JavaScript和HTML将尤为重要。

              #### 创建钱包的基本步骤

              创建钱包的基本步骤包括:配置开发环境、实现账户创建功能、集成区块链API等。逐步进行开发,渐渐实现一个简易的USDT钱包。

              ### 6. USDT钱包的安全性 #### 常见的安全隐患

              在USDT钱包的设计中,用户需要特别注意各种安全隐患。网络钓鱼、恶意软件、服务器漏洞等都可能导致用户资产被窃取。任何小的安全漏洞都有可能被黑客利用。

              #### 如何防范黑客攻击

              为了防范黑客攻击,用户应该使用多重签名技术、双因素认证等方式确保安全。此外,定期更新钱包软件和操作系统也非常重要。

              ### 7. 钱包的最佳实践 #### 定期备份与恢复

              为了确保资产不丢失,用户应定期备份他们的钱包并计划恢复流程,这是最佳实践之一。备份资料应该存放在安全、离线的地方。

              #### 加强个人信息的保护

              用户还需要保护个人信息,不随意泄露关于自己钱包的任何信息,尤其是私钥、助记词等。一旦这些信息被盗取,用户将面临巨大的资产风险。

              ### 8. 总结与前瞻 #### 未来的USDT钱包发展趋势

              随着加密货币的不断发展,USDT钱包也在不断演变。未来,随着技术的发展,USDT钱包将变得更加安全,用户体验也会不断提升。

              #### 用户的角色与责任

              用户在使用USDT钱包时不仅要关注功能的实现,更要重视安全性与隐私保护。作为数字资产的使用者,用户应时刻学习和提升自己的安全意识。

              ### 9. 相关问题解答 #### USDT钱包的法律合规性如何?

              USDT钱包的法律合规性因地区而异。在某些国家,使用加密货币需要遵守相关法律法规,用户在创建与使用钱包时应了解当地法律,并根据要求进行申报与纳税。

              #### 如何选择一个可靠的USDT钱包?

              选择可靠的USDT钱包首先要关注其安全性和用户评价。推荐选择知名度较高的、经过多次审核的钱包应用,另外,查看是否有开源代码和多重认证功能也是选择时的重要参考指标。

              #### USDT钱包是否会被黑客攻击?

              尽管USDT钱包的安全性不断提升,但依然存在着被黑客攻击的风险。黑客可能通过各种技术手段获取用户的私钥,从而盗取资产。因此,用户应加强安全防范,定期监测自己的钱包。

              #### 我可以同时使用多个USDT钱包吗?

              当然,用户可以根据需求同时使用多个USDT钱包,以便在不同的交易场景下使用最佳的空间。多钱包的使用有助于分散风险,但需要用户管理好各个钱包的私钥与安全信息。

              #### USDT的存储和转账时间有多长?

              USDT的存储和转账时间一般是实时的,具体时间可能取决于网络的拥堵状态。在高峰时段,转账确认可能会有延迟,但大多数转账通常在几分钟之内完成。

              #### 如何备份我的USDT钱包?

              备份USDT钱包的步骤通常包括导出私钥和助记词,并将其保存至安全的地点。许多钱包提供一键备份功能,用户应熟悉这一功能操作,将备份信息进行加密存储。

              以上内容为《如何构建一个安全的USDT钱包:源代码解析与最佳实践》的大纲和详述,满足3500字以上的需求。如何构建一个安全的USDT钱包:源代码解析与最佳实践如何构建一个安全的USDT钱包:源代码解析与最佳实践
              分享 :
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                  相关新闻

                                                  为了帮助您更好地理解比
                                                  2024-10-10
                                                  为了帮助您更好地理解比

                                                  ```### 内容主体大纲1. **引言** - 比特币的背景 - 什么是全节点钱包2. **什么是全节点钱包** - 定义 - 与轻节点钱包的区...

                                                  如何在Tokenim上购买TRX:步
                                                  2024-10-09
                                                  如何在Tokenim上购买TRX:步

                                                  ## 大纲1. **引言** - 什么是TRX? - Tokenim平台概述 - 为什么选择Tokenim购买TRX?2. **获取Tokenim账户** - 注册步骤 - 完成KY...

                                                  如何在没有钱包的情况下
                                                  2024-12-21
                                                  如何在没有钱包的情况下

                                                  ### 内容主体大纲1. 什么是狗狗币? - 狗狗币的起源 - 狗狗币的特性2. 钱包的基本概念与功能 - 什么是加密货币钱包?...

                                                  伊朗智库对加密货币的影
                                                  2024-10-07
                                                  伊朗智库对加密货币的影

                                                  ### 内容主体大纲1. 引言 - 加密货币的兴起 - 伊朗在加密货币领域的背景2. 伊朗智库的角色 - 政策建议 - 研究和分析...